- Egg White and Yogurt Mask:
Ingredients:
- 1 egg
- 3 tbsp thick yogurt
- 2 tsp coconut oil
- 5-6 drops lavender essential oil (optional)
Instructions:
- Mix 1 egg and 3 tbsp thick yogurt until smooth.
- Add 2 tsp coconut oil and 5-6 drops of lavender essential oil (optional). Blend well.
- Apply the mask from scalp to hair roots, focusing on the hair. Use a shower cap to avoid drips.
- Leave on for 45 minutes to 1 hour for optimal results.
- Rinse with cold water, followed by a mild shampoo. Cold water retains moisture, giving a silky finish.
- Egg white’s protein nourishes hair, providing a natural silky texture, while yogurt’s fatty acids promote growth and eliminate dandruff.
Tip: Always use cold water to rinse off the mask, particularly with an egg-based mask, as hot water can make residue removal challenging.
- Mayonnaise and Coconut Milk Hair Mask:
Ingredients:
- 3 tsp mayonnaise
- 1 egg
- 3-4 tsp coconut milk
Instructions:
- Mix 2-3 tsp mayonnaise and 1 egg until thick.
- Add 3 tsp coconut milk and blend to achieve a mayonnaise-like consistency.
- Apply generously from scalp to roots on slightly damp hair.
- Wear a shower cap and leave for 1 hour before rinsing with cold water and shampoo.
- This mask strengthens, smoothens, and promotes hair growth, preventing lice with its nourishing ingredients.
Tip: Regular application, once a week, repairs dull and damaged hair, transforming texture and appearance.
- Avocado Hair Mask:
Ingredients:
- 2 ripe avocados
- 1 egg
- Honey and curd (or banana as a substitute)
- Optional: 1/2 tsp olive oil
Instructions:
- Blend 2 ripe avocados with 1 egg.
- Add 2 tsp yogurt, 1 tsp honey, and optional olive oil. Mix thoroughly.
- Apply to detangled, sectioned hair, leaving for 40 minutes to 1:30 hours.
- Rinse with cold water and condition if desired.
- Results vary based on hair texture, with damaged hair requiring more nourishment.
- Aloe Vera and Glycerin Hair Mask:
Ingredients:
- 2-3 tsp aloe vera gel
- 2-4 tsp rose water
- 1 tsp glycerin
- Optional: A few drops of lavender essential oil
Instructions:
- Mix aloe vera gel, rose water, and glycerin for a semi-liquid consistency.
- Optionally add a few drops of lavender essential oil.
- Apply as a hair mask or spray for an overnight silky texture.
- Ideal for dull, lifeless hair, this mask provides nourishment, leaving hair dramatically silky.
Tip: Adjust glycerin quantity based on hair length; excellent for winter use
